Transaction 23268aef6817028fc24eadcd05c7b3375ca17ded8e85f44643b07f9fe8ad8c96
1 Input
2 Outputs
- 23268aef6817028fc24eadcd05c7b3375ca17ded8e85f44643b07f9fe8ad8c96:0
- 23268aef6817028fc24eadcd05c7b3375ca17ded8e85f44643b07f9fe8ad8c96:1
value 8755911
address 1K87xHXySvQ1XNpos87tJHyBoUywoCCULJ
value 10140354
address 1ABKVjiWxuFRnGkQjhs1X9quMU4TWycevd